One of the first things travelers need is efficient ticket purchase and collection. At Haywards Heath, the station ensures a smooth ticketing experience. The ticket office operates from early morning till late evening throughout the week. Alternatively, ticket machines are available for quick purchases to help you get on your way, and they even acc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
The station is designed with accessibility in mind, offering step-free access throughout, making it a Category A station. For those who require additional support, assistance is available from station staff, ensuring that everyone can make their way smoothly onto the trains. While accessible toilets are unfortunately not available, the station is equipped with induction loops and ramps for train access to help those who might need them.
For tech-savvy travelers, however, it should be noted that public Wi-Fi is currently unavailable at the station. But if you’re planning to make a quick stop and need cash on the go, ATMs can be found at the station to accommodate your needs. The convenience extends to cycle storage too, with over 300 spaces available for bike enthusiasts.
Getting to and from Haywards Heath station is a breeze. The station features a well-maintained taxi rank right outside its main entrance, simplifying the journey to your next destination. For those preferring buses, detailed travel information can be easily found within the station premises to plan your onward journey effectively.
Though there are no onsite shops or refreshment facilities, the town center is just a short walk away, where you can find plenty of options to grab a bite or shop around.

While Shiplake Station doesn't boast a ticket office, it is equipped with ticket machines, making it convenient for travelers to purchase and collect tickets on-site. The station ensures accessibility for all with step-free access and accessible ticket machines that cater to passengers with mobility challenges. Although you won't find refreshment facilities or shops here, the inviting village of Shiplake offers various local eateries and shops to discover.
The station provides convenient connections for those planning to travel beyond Shiplake. For travelers seeking to reach major airports, you can seamlessly change at Reading for connections to Heathrow and Gatwick airports. However, it's worth noting that there are no direct taxi services available at the station. Instead, a bus stop for rail replacement services is conveniently located by the War Memorial, guiding passengers to their next destination. Information for onward journey planning is readily available in printable format, ensuring you have a smooth transition between modes of transport.
